About 4-hydroxy-3-(5-methyl-1-benzofuran-2-carbonyl)-1-(2-morpholin-4-ylethyl)-2-(3-prop-2-enoxyphenyl)-2H-pyrrol-5-one

4-hydroxy-3-(5-methyl-1-benzofuran-2-carbonyl)-1-(2-morpholin-4-ylethyl)-2-(3-prop-2-enoxyphenyl)-2H-pyrrol-5-one (PubChem CID 5268690) has the molecular formula C29H30N2O6 and a molecular weight of 502.57 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 4-hydroxy-3-(5-methyl-1-benzofuran-2-carbonyl)-1-(2-morpholin-4-ylethyl)-2-(3-prop-2-enoxyphenyl)-2H-pyrrol-5-one.
